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> [php][sql] pobranie danych i ich wyswietlenie w <select>
kosmic
post
Post #1





Grupa: Zarejestrowani
Postów: 132
Pomógł: 0
Dołączył: 31.10.2007

Ostrzeżenie: (0%)
-----


a wiec, powiedzmy ze podczas instalacji galeri bede dodawał perwszy i podstawowy rekord do swojej bazy...

no i teraz jest tak, ze mam w bazie rzechowywane to jaks "1" lub "0"... no i chce to pobrac i wyswietlic wartosc w postaci "TAK" lub "Nie" w moim formularzu jak wejde na strone gdzie sie on znajduje....

troche zamotałm, ale chodzi o to ze mam take pole w formularzu:
Kod
<SELECT class="form_tak_nie" NAME="pokaz_st">
    <OPTION VALUE="Nie">Nie</OPTION>
    <OPTION VALUE="Tak">Tak</OPTION>
    </SELECT>


no i teraz pobiram sobie dane z tabeli "config" i je wyswietlam we formularzu, no i w przypadku pól <input> i <textarea> wiem jak sobie wyswietlic aktualne dane z tabeli, ale wlasnie w <select> nie wiem...

ktos pomoze (IMG:http://forum.php.pl/style_emoticons/default/questionmark.gif) .... o prostu chce aby jesli w bazie mam "1" to fomularz jakby docelowo wskazywał na "Tak", natomiast jesli "0" to wchodząc na strone ustawienia gdzie wlasnie jest ten formularz.. widze ustawione "Nie" w polu wyboru (IMG:http://forum.php.pl/style_emoticons/default/questionmark.gif)

teraz chyba wsio jasne (IMG:http://forum.php.pl/style_emoticons/default/questionmark.gif)
jak to zrobic (IMG:http://forum.php.pl/style_emoticons/default/questionmark.gif)
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i
Hazel
post
Post #2





Grupa: Zarejestrowani
Postów: 492
Pomógł: 33
Dołączył: 16.08.2007
Skąd: Wrocław

Ostrzeżenie: (0%)
-----


  1. <?php
  2. $query = "SELECT pole_wyboru FROM tabela WHERE id='$id'";
  3. $result = mysql_query($query);
  4. $row = mysql_fetch_array($result);
  5. $zm = $row['pole_wyboru'];
  6. if ($zm == 1)
  7. {
  8. echo ' selected';
  9. }
  10. ?>

edit: oczywiście w odpowiednim miejscu, przed tym kodem php musi być html tworzący select i którąś z opcji, mam nadzieję że troche kumasz php i zrozumiesz, że to tylko schemat, tak samo musisz se zapytanie na własne potrzeby przerobić.

Ten post edytował Hazel 28.12.2007, 20:20:10
Go to the top of the page
+Quote Post

Posty w temacie


Reply to this topicStart new topic
2 Użytkowników czyta ten temat (2 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 8.10.2025 - 10:51